neomys fodiens Sentence Examples

  1. Neomys fodiens, the Eurasian water shrew, is a small semi-aquatic mammal found in Europe and Asia.
  2. The neomys fodiens's diet consists mainly of aquatic insects, worms, and small fish.
  3. Neomys fodiens is a skilled swimmer and can dive underwater to catch prey.
  4. The neomys fodiens's fur is waterproof, allowing it to spend extended periods in the water.
  5. Neomys fodiens typically lives in burrows near bodies of water.
  6. The neomys fodiens is a territorial animal and will defend its territory from other shrews.
  7. Neomys fodiens is a solitary animal except during the breeding season.
  8. The neomys fodiens has a lifespan of around 2 years.
  9. Neomys fodiens is a protected species in some countries due to its declining population.
  10. The neomys fodiens is an important part of the aquatic ecosystem, playing a role in controlling insect populations.
